Tell us what support your group needs and win £100

Posted on 15th Dec

Plymouth Change Up Consortium, working with Plymouth 2020, aims to create sustainable and effective voluntary and community sectors (the Third Sector) in the city. To help achieve this, Lin Whitfield Consultancy has been commissioned to carry out independent research into the support needs of the Third Sector in Plymouth.

This research is being funded by Capacity Builders (a national programme) to ensure that the right support for the Third Sector is developed in Plymouth. The findings will inform what kind of support is provided in future, including both practical support and strategic engagement. Completing this survey gives you the opportunity to shape local support services in the city.

The information you provide will only be used to inform our report to Plymouth Change Up Consortium. No details about individual organisations will be included.

The research findings will be presented at an event in late March/early April 2009 and a summary of the report will be published at the same time to ensure that you get feedback about the outcomes of the survey.
